JOHN MAUZY PITTMAN, Judge.

Before his death, Kenneth Allen filled in the blanks on a will form. After Mr. Allen passed away, appellee, the primary beneficiary under the purported will, sought to have it admitted to probate. The trial judge ruled that it was a valid holographic will and granted appellee's petition. Appellant, Mr. Allen's daughter, argues that this was error because the will did not comport with the statutory requirements applicable to holographic wills...
